Among the most common deficiencies are vitamin C deficiency , which causes chronic fatigue, vitamin D deficiency, which causes rickets and iron deficiency, which is the cause of anemia. In case of vitamin C deficiency, one can observe a big fatigue, problems of cicatrization, the appearance of hematomas, joint pains and a general decrease of the immunity.

In case of vitamin D deficiency, the bones are weakened, the teeth can deteriorate, a retardation of growth can appear in the children.

Iron deficiency is characterized by abnormal pallor and weakness, chronic fatigue, often followed by anemia .

Fight against deficiencies

Most of the deficiencies are of food origin. So you must be careful to vary and balance your diet to provide your body with minerals, vitamins and nutrients that are essential.

Vitamin C is found in many plants, including green vegetables, citrus fruits and fresh fruits. Concentrated lemon juice and orange juice are excellent sources of vitamin C, as are kiwi , guava and cabbages .

Spend thirty minutes each day in the sun, giving you the vitamin D you need, but protecting your skin.

A high concentration of vitamin D is contained in salmon , fish oils , liver , egg yolk or dairy products.

Iron is very present in eggs , meats, fish and dairy products. To preserve the nutrients of your food, be sure to favor soft cooking and fresh products.
